J.R.R. Tolkien wrote his books on Middle-earth from a Christian worldview, not necessarily because he wanted everyone to take that from his work, but because that's how he sees the world working. It isn't blatently obvious that The Lord of the Rings has Christian themes, but you don't need to look hard for them. Middle-earth is enjoyable to people for numerous reasons, and the Christian world view isn't necessarily one of them.
